Abstract

Fastgrowing poplar wood was modified by watersoluble ammoniacal copper quaternary (ACQD) using vacuumimpregnating method. Mechanical and sorption isotherm performance of untreated and modified wood with ACQD, were studied in this paper. The results showed that the effects of treatment with ACQD using vacuummethod on mechanical performance of fastgrowing poplar wood was not significant. Nelson equation could describe sorption performance of untreated and modified wood with ACQD well. Antidecay modification didn’t change sorption nature of poplar wood.
